Output 74572451a16b24761705919ee6bf95f4d341623f5741475a5ad760a1d32e2752:8

value
32514504
script pubkey
OP_0 OP_PUSHBYTES_32 7775cda13b1b53747ae8e1402cfaba349650ae17362ac4f3854daa4ceba26761
address
bc1qwa6umgfmrdfhg7hgu9qze746xjt9ptshxc4vfuu9fk4ye6azvasshsc5de
transaction
74572451a16b24761705919ee6bf95f4d341623f5741475a5ad760a1d32e2752
spent
true